The use of train horns originated in the late 1800s as a practical means of communication for train operators. These horns were initially operated manually by the crew on board, requiring physical exertion to sound the alert. Over time, technological advancements led to the development of more efficient and automated train horns, resulting in enhanced safety measures for both trains and pedestrians. Today, train horns are an integral part of the transportation infrastructure, ensuring that railway crossings are adequately marked and signaling approaching trains. 2. How does a high-volume compressed air horn work?

A high-volume compressed air horn functions by utilizing compressed air from an external source. When the horn is activated, the air is forced through a small opening, creating a high-pressure sound wave. This produces a distinct and attention-grabbing sound that can be heard over long distances, ensuring that the intended signal reaches its recipient.

5. How can high-volume compressed air horns be properly maintained?

Proper maintenance is crucial to ensure the optimal performance and longevity of high-volume compressed air horns. Regular inspection and cleaning are essential to prevent dust and debris accumulation, which can affect the horn's functionality. Additionally, lubricating moving parts and checking for any signs of wear or damage is important for identifying and addressing issues in a timely manner. Finally, following the manufacturer's guidelines for maintenance and replacing worn-out components when necessary will help to keep the horn in peak condition.
